Uploaded image for project: 'Red Hat Developer Hub Bugs'
  1. Red Hat Developer Hub Bugs
  2. RHDHBUGS-2289

Custom plugins on Installed Packages UI are incorrectly showing as disabled

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Unresolved
    • Icon: Normal Normal
    • None
    • 1.8.0
    • Dynamic Plugins, Marketplace, UI
    • None
    • False
    • Hide

      None

      Show
      None
    • False

      Description of problem:

      Building and installing a third party plugin results in it correctly being listed on the Installed Packages UI, but the toggle is in the off position even if the plugin is enabled in dynamic-plugins.yaml

      The tooltip indicates that the catalog entity for the plugin is missing, but it could be more helpful by directing users to documentation with example configurations (https://github.com/redhat-developer/rhdh-plugin-export-overlays/tree/main/catalog-entities/marketplace/#packages , https://github.com/redhat-developer/rhdh-plugin-export-overlays/tree/main/catalog-entities/marketplace/#plugins )

      Prerequisites (if any, like setup, operators/versions):

      Build an install a plugin in RHDH 1.8, e.g https://docs.google.com/document/d/1ax53BzVxMcZtSwS7T2LYZ4pqGHt7-bl3dYVdjwRDUSA/edit?tab=t.0

      Steps to Reproduce

      Build an install a plugin in RHDH 1.8, e.g https://docs.google.com/document/d/1ax53BzVxMcZtSwS7T2LYZ4pqGHt7-bl3dYVdjwRDUSA/edit?tab=t.0

      Actual results:

      Toggle is in disabled position

      Expected results:

      Toggle is in enabled position
      Tooltip content should have a link that points to the catalog-entity examples
      Figma: https://www.figma.com/design/E6C9X3OSVzlWkW7ZsbxN7s/Administration?node-id=6479-4429&t=btNOVMFSwWBoAQ9j-1

      Reproducibility (Always/Intermittent/Only Once):

      Always

      Build Details:

      RHDH Version: 1.8.0
      Backstage Version: 1.42.5
      Last Commit: redhat-developer/rhdh @ d58642e0
      Build Time: 2025-11-10T18:19:10Z

      Additional info (Such as Logs, Screenshots, etc):

              dsantra12 Debsmita Santra
              eshortis Evan Shortiss
              RHIDP - Frontend Plugins & UI
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Created:
                Updated: